CompX International reported fiscal year 2018 executive compensation information on April 16, 2019.
In 2018, five executives at CompX International received on average a compensation package of $562K, a 18% increase compared to previous year.
Scott C. James, Chief Executive Officer, received $1M in total, which increased by 10% compared to 2017. 54% of James' compensation, or $550K, was in bonus. James also received $424K in salary and $40K in other compensation.
For fiscal year 2018, the median employee pay was $49,583 at CompX International. Therefore, the ratio of Scott C. James' pay to the median employee pay was 20 to one.
James W. Brown, Chief Financial Officer, received a compensation package of $766K, which increased by 8% compared to previous year. 100% of the compensation package, or $766K, was in salary.
Robert D. Graham, Chairman, earned $409K in 2018, a 71% increase compared to previous year.
Gregory B. Swalwell, Executive Vice President, received $315K in 2018, which increases by 50% compared to 2017.
Andrew B. Nace, Executive Vice President, earned $306K in 2018, a 42% increase compared to previous year.
